## Understanding the Art of Flavor
The chemistry of flavor is much more nuanced than simply adding salt or a dash of pepper. Flavor is a symphony composed of taste, aroma, texture, and even temperature. When these elements come together in harmony, every bite becomes an unforgettable experience.
**Key components of a flavor explosion:**
1. **Umami:** The “fifth taste” found in foods like mushrooms, soy sauce, and aged cheeses.
2. **Contrast:** Balancing sweet, sour, salty, bitter, and spicy elements.
3. **Fresh Herbs & Aromatics:** Basil, cilantro, garlic, and ginger awaken your senses.
4. **Textures:** Creamy, crunchy, chewy—mixing these creates excitement.
## The Secret Ingredient: Layering Flavors
Professional chefs know that the greatest dishes aren’t built in a moment—they’re crafted by layering flavors. This technique involves introducing ingredients at different stages of cooking, allowing each one to impart its full essence. For instance, sautéing onions first, then adding garlic, followed by spices, and finally a splash of acid (like lemon juice or vinegar), turns a simple dish into a complex, savory masterpiece.
## Recipe for a Flavor Explosion: Try This at Home!
**Sizzling Citrus Garlic Chicken**
**Ingredients:**
- 2 boneless chicken breasts
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 1 tbsp butter
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- Zest and juice of 1 lemon
- 1 tsp smoked paprika
- 1/2 tsp chili flakes
- Salt and black pepper to taste
- Fresh cilantro or parsley, chopped
**Instructions:**
1. **Marinate** the chicken in lemon zest, juice, paprika, salt, and pepper for at least 30 minutes.
2. In a skillet, heat olive oil and butter over medium-high heat. Sear chicken on both sides until golden brown.
3. Add minced garlic and chili flakes, sautéing until fragrant.
4. Pour in any leftover marinade, reducing to create a glossy sauce.
5. Plate the chicken, drizzle with sauce, and sprinkle generously with fresh herbs.
**Tip:** Serve with a crisp salad or roasted vegetables for added contrast!
## Beyond the Recipe: Experiment and Explore
Your kitchen is your lab—don’t be afraid to experiment! Try adding roasted nuts for crunch, a splash of balsamic reduction for sweetness, or a dollop of spicy aioli for heat. Each tweak brings you closer to your personal flavor explosion.
